About Silvia Gervasoni

Silvia Gervasoni is a scholar working on Molecular Medicine, Computational Theory and Mathematics and Behavioral Neuroscience, having authored 49 papers that have together received 814 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Computational Drug Discovery Methods (11 papers),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(6 papers), Protein Structure and Dynamics (5 papers), Biochemical effects in animals (4 papers),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(4 papers), Cholinesterase and Neurodegenerative Diseases (4 papers), Immune Cell Function and Interaction (4 papers) and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Molecular Medicine (57 citations), Computational Theory and Mathematics (123 citations) and Immunology (158 citations). Silvia Gervasoni has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, Argentina and United States. Frequent co-authors include Pablo Matar, Viviana R. Rozados, Giulio Vistoli, Alessandro Pedretti, O. Graciela Scharovsky, Angelica Mazzolari, Laura Fumagalli, Carmine Talarico, Andrea R. Beccari and Giuliano Malloci. Their work appears in journals such as Bioinformatics, Scientific Reports and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
